CVE-2002-1937
Symantec Firewall/VPN Appliance 100 through 200R hardcodes the administrator’s MAC address inside the firewall’s configuration, which allows remote attackers to spoof the administrator’s MAC address and perform an ARP poisoning man-in-the-middle attack to obtain the administrator’s password.
